Spencer/Columbus football whips Rib Lake/Prentice in regular-season finale

By Hub City Times
October 15, 2016
623
0
Share:

Rockets head into playoffs at 7-2


By Paul Lecker

Sports Reporter

RIB LAKE — Sophomore quarterback Jarred Mandel threw for 177 yards and three touchdowns to help the Spencer/Columbus Catholic football team to a 43-8 rout of Rib Lake/Prentice on Friday night at Rib Lake High School.

Mandel threw TD passes of 26 and 81 yards to Ethan Meece and one for 11 yards to Karak Bushman for the Rockets, who finish the regular season with a 7-2 record.

Meece finished with four catches for 119 yards, and Noah Zastrow rushed for 125 yards and three touchdowns for Spencer/Columbus.

Spencer scored five touchdowns in the first half, including two from Zastrow and Mandel’s three TD throws, to take a 31-0 lead at intermission.

Zastrow and Leonardo Rodriguez added touchdown runs in the second half.

Colt Logan had a 68-yard touchdown run for the Hawks’ only score. The run accounted for one-third of Rib Lake/Prentice’s offense for the night as Spencer/Columbus outgained the Hawks 407-210.

Rockets 43, Hawks 8

Spencer/Columbus 12 19 6 6 – 43

Rib Lake/Prentice 0 0 0 8 – 8

First Quarter

SC – Ethan Meece 26 pass from Jarred Mandel (run failed), 8:04.
SC – Karak Bushman 11 pass from Mandel (pass failed), 2:06.

Second Quarter

SC – Noah Zastrow 36 run (run failed), 11:52.
SC – Meece 81 pass from Mandel (pass failed), 8:43.
SC – Zastrow 35 run (Caden Schillinger kick), 6:56.

Third Quarter

SC – Zastrow 16 run (kick failed), 7:21.

Fourth Quarter

RLP – Colt Logan 68 run (Kai Vedder kick), 7:28.
SC – Leonardo Rodriguez 5 run (kick blocked), 1:07.

Team Statistics

First downs: SC 22; RLP 9.

Rushing (att-yards): SC 35-239; RLP 38-167.

Passing (comp-att-yards-int): SC 8-21-168-2; RLP 4-16-43-0.

Penalties (no.-yards): SC 3-25; RLP 5-35.

Fumbles (total-lost): SC 0-0; RLP 3-3.

Punting (no.-avg.): SC none; RLP 3-6.0.

Individual Statistics

Rushing: SC, Noah Zastrow 14-125, Andres Rodriguez 3-33, Carson Hildebrandt 8-28, Shane Hamm 2-21, Austin Bacon 2-14, Jacob Miller 5-13, Leonardo Rodriguez 1-5. RLP, Colt Logan 4-76, Hunter Swan 12-46, Taylor Brayton 10-27, Kai Vedder 8-16, Drew Rohde 3-3, No. 35 (no name provided) 1-minus 1.

Passing: SC, Jarred Mandel 7-20-177-2, Zastrow 1-1-minus 9-0. RLP, Ta. Brayton 4-16-43-0.

Receiving: SC, Ethan Meece 4-119, Karak Bushman 2-21, Hildebrandt 1-17, Miller 1-11. RLP, Trace Brayton 2-17, Rohde 1-21, Swan 1-5.

Records: Spencer/Columbus Catholic 7-2; Rib Lake/Prentice 6-3.
